当前位置:编程学习 > JAVA >>

Java的classpath

java安装中classpath环境变量到底有什么作用,感觉有没有它都没有多大区别? --------------------编程问答-------------------- 根据classpath来获取jar的文件 --------------------编程问答-------------------- classpath一般会配置dt.jar和tools.jar的路径。

dt.jar是关于运行环境的类库,主要是swing的包
tools.jar是关于一些工具的类库。

编译和运行需要的都是toos.jar里面的类
分别是
sun.tools.java.*;
sun.tols.javac.*; 

如果没有配置java的环境变量,java  javac  等命令,你是执行不了的。 --------------------编程问答-------------------- classpath顾名思义,设置Classpath的目的,在于告诉Java执行环境,在哪些目录下可以找到您所要执行的Java程序所需要的类或者包。 --------------------编程问答-------------------- 运行环境。。没有环境怎么搞。
--------------------编程问答-------------------- 因为你还没怎么开始用,所以感觉classpath没什么用。 --------------------编程问答-------------------- 就像你把系统的classpath删了,那运行基本就没用了 --------------------编程问答-------------------- 从1.4还是哪个版本就不需要配置classpath了 --------------------编程问答-------------------- 不要设置classpath

若一定要设置,记得写上 [.;] --------------------编程问答--------------------
引用 7 楼 huntor 的回复:
从1.4还是哪个版本就不需要配置classpath了
顶一个!后面的不需要配置classpath的。绝不虚言 --------------------编程问答-------------------- 放弃eclipse之类的IDE,在试试。 --------------------编程问答--------------------
引用 9 楼 Gaowen_HAN 的回复:
Quote: 引用 7 楼 huntor 的回复:

从1.4还是哪个版本就不需要配置classpath了
顶一个!后面的不需要配置classpath的。绝不虚言
确实,配置classpath反而容易出事,因为你配对了还好,如果配置时掉个.  ,就会在当前目录下运行还找不到,你还会半天不知道怎么回事。 --------------------编程问答-------------------- 环境变量配置,必须熟悉,基本功了,估计你没用过命令来编译解释 java 代码 --------------------编程问答--------------------
补充:Java ,  Java SE
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,